EG Group in Horwich is looking for a Credit Control Team Leader to oversee a team of Credit Controllers. This role requires expertise in debt collection and team management, alongside strong analytical skills.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ining customer relationships and driving performance metrics.

The role offers hybrid working options and several employee perks including a performance-based bonus scheme and career growth opportunities within a global organization.
